What are the best types of boat storage for the extreme summer heat in Maricopa, AZ?

Given Maricopa's desert climate with summer temperatures often exceeding 110°F, covered or indoor storage is highly recommended to protect your boat from intense UV rays, which can fade gel coats, crack upholstery, and degrade electronics. Many local facilities offer shaded canopies or fully enclosed, climate-controlled units. While outdoor storage is more affordable, the long-term damage from sun exposure often outweighs the cost savings. Prioritize facilities with good ventilation to prevent heat buildup and mold.

How does the lack of major waterways near Maricopa affect storage options and pricing?

Unlike lakeside cities, Maricopa is inland, so most storage is 'dry stack' or on-land storage, as opposed to wet slips. This generally makes storage more affordable and widely available compared to coastal or lakeside areas in Arizona. However, you'll need to factor in transportation costs to and from popular boating destinations like Lake Pleasant or the Colorado River, which are about a 1-2 hour drive. Many storage facilities in Maricopa cater specifically to trailerable boats and RVs, offering wide driveways and easy in/out access for frequent hauling.

Are there specific security concerns I should look for in a Maricopa boat storage facility?

Yes. While Maricopa is generally safe, you should prioritize facilities with robust security features. Look for properties with 24/7 video surveillance, well-lit premises, tall perimeter fencing with controlled gate access (preferably with personalized codes), and possibly on-site management. Given the high value of boats and trailers, these measures are crucial to deter theft and vandalism. It's also wise to inquire about their protocol for after-hours access and if they have any recorded security incidents.

What seasonal considerations are unique to storing a boat in the Maricopa area?

The primary seasonality revolves around extreme heat and the Arizona monsoon (roughly June-September). During summer, proper ventilation and sun protection are critical. The monsoon brings high winds, dust storms, and occasional hail, making covered or enclosed storage vital to avoid damage. The 'off-season' (fall through spring) features ideal boating weather, so storage facilities may see higher turnover. Unlike colder states, there's no need to winterize for freezing, but you should 'summerize' your boat by protecting plastics, batteries, and fluids from heat degradation.

What are the typical price ranges for boat storage in Maricopa, and what factors influence the cost?

Prices in Maricopa are generally competitive due to available land. You can expect to pay approximately $50-$150 per month. Key cost factors include: the type of storage (outdoor uncovered is cheapest, followed by covered canopy, then fully enclosed or climate-controlled), the size of your boat and trailer (length is the primary determinant), and included amenities like 24/7 access, electricity for trickle chargers, or on-site dump stations. Facilities closer to major roads like State Route 347 or the I-10 may command a slight premium for convenience.

Essential Winter Boat Storage Tips for Maricopa, AZ Boat Owners

As the summer heat fades and the cooler months approach in Maricopa, Arizona, many boat owners start thinking about winter storage. While our winters are mild compared to northern states, proper off-season storage is still crucial to protect your investment from the unique desert climate. Finding reliable winter boat storage near you involves more than just securing a spot; it's about ensuring your vessel is ready to hit the water when spring returns.

Maricopa's dry climate presents both advantages and challenges for boat storage. The low humidity reduces mold and mildew risks, but intense sun exposure and temperature fluctuations can damage upholstery, fade gel coats, and dry out seals. When searching for storage facilities, prioritize options that offer covered or indoor storage to shield your boat from UV rays. Many local storage yards in and around Maricopa provide RV and boat storage with features like shaded canopies, which are ideal for our environment.

Before storing your boat, thorough preparation is key. Start by giving your vessel a deep clean, removing all organic matter to prevent pests—a common issue in desert areas. Flush the cooling system with fresh water to eliminate any salt or debris from trips to nearby lakes like Lake Pleasant or the Colorado River. Completely drain all water from the engine, bilge, and live wells to prevent freezing during our occasional cold snaps. Add a fuel stabilizer to a full tank to prevent condensation and fuel degradation over the winter months.

Consider local storage regulations and accessibility. Some Maricopa storage facilities may have specific requirements for winterized boats, so check their policies. If you plan to perform maintenance during the off-season, look for a facility that allows owner access. For those with larger boats, ensure the storage location can accommodate your vessel's size and provide easy maneuvering space.

Don't overlook security and insurance. Choose a storage facility with good lighting, fencing, and surveillance cameras. Verify that your boat insurance covers winter storage, especially if storing outside of Maricopa city limits. Taking these steps will give you peace of mind throughout the winter months.

By investing time in proper preparation and selecting the right storage solution, you'll protect your boat from Arizona's winter elements and ensure it's in top condition for your next adventure on our beautiful local waterways.
